Management Rating from FrancisM

Nemean Lion Key Player
Nemean Lion Key Player

-9223372036854775808/10
 (-9223372036854775808/10)
-9223372036854775808/10
 (-9223372036854775808/10)
-9223372036854775808/10
 (-9223372036854775808/10)